THE dates for two Royston Town cup finals have been announced.
The Crows will play St Margaretsbury in the final of the Reserve Challenge Trophy final on Thursday, April 30 at Broxbourne, and will play Ampthill in the Division One Cup final at Biggleswade Town two days later on Saturday, May 2.
Meanwhile, Royston continued their push for promotion from Division One with a comfortable 4-0 victory away to Cranfield United last night (Thursday).
Goals from David Cain, Ryan Lockett, Tom Malins and Ricky Young went without reply in what was Royston's last catch-up match on second placed Kings Langley.
With both teams having now played 34 matches each, Royston lead the table with 85 points compared to Langley's 71.
